          Re: Knife Badge - Frustrating!

          Don't run around with your knife out. Not only do you look retarder, it is retarded!
          Use your standard gun to keep you safe while you move into position. The secret to good knifing is to never pull it until you are ready to use it. I suggest going medic for the badge since if you play medic, you are already used to not being able to count on your gun and moving quickly.

            Re: Knife Badge - Frustrating!

            Never run around with your knife drawn... I totally agree there.

            As some of us pointed out, when you see somebody nearby not shooting at you, you have a 1 chance in 2 not firing at him, that is... until you realized he is wearing the wrong uniform... That's why you can end up running along enemies without them really understanding what is happening (as was already stated before).

            To me, another players with his gun seems less dangerous than a guys wiht a knife... Chances are it's a buddy. If I see a knife I get cautious until I recognize him for a friend.

            All this long rant to write about my first tries to get the knife badge: I thought about stealth and surprise. Thus I chose to use the Sniper kit. First and foremost reason is that nothing looks more like a sniper than another sniper, be they USMC, PLA or MEC. That is... until you get real close. And did you notice how long it take for the name tag to appear above a sniper when you look at him? Enemy or Friendly? That is the question. And that's how I bagged some of my first knife kills. I would play sniper and approach my target with sniper rifle in hand. Pistols would also have been ok but people can also be cautious of all-out-pistols guys whereas most of them think "duh... a sniper approaching me with a rifle? Only a friend would dare". And then SLASH! SURPRISE!. It worked great but the trouble is if you missed the first slash you shall received a whole load of lead and everybody knows lead in dangerous to your health :p

            In the end I got my Basic & Veteran with the Assault class. Better armor, better survival rates when you rush the last 5 to 10 meters with your knife out when the enemy wastes bullets at you firing from the hip with an awful recoil...

            For those nasty guys who happen to own BF2:SF and who have unlocked the Assault weappon (F2000N) have you noticed you have a flashbang instead of a regular grenade? Great for knife kills: you spot a bunch of players (or even isolated ones), you blind them and then you slash them from ear to ear while they are running headlong in walls or crates...

            I know it's not "fair" but who said close quarter knife fight is fair?
